网络设备和联网方法
    3.
    发明授权

    公开(公告)号:CN113542210B

    公开(公告)日:2022-12-20

    申请号:CN202110399946.X

    申请日:2021-04-14

    Abstract: 在一个实施方式中,网络设备包括接口,该接口被配置为接收包括报头部分的数据分组,至少一个解析器以解析报头部分的数据以产生第一报头部分和第二报头部分,分组处理引擎以获取第一匹配和动作表,响应于第一报头部分,匹配具有第一匹配和动作表中的相应第一转向动作条目的第一索引,响应于第一转向动作条目基于第一报头部分和第二报头部分计算累积查找值,响应于第一转向动作条目获取第二匹配和动作表,响应于累积查找值匹配具有第二匹配和动作表中的相应第二转向动作条目的第二索引,并响应于第二转向动作条目转向分组。

    通用分组报头插入和移除
    6.
    发明公开

    公开(公告)号:CN113225303A

    公开(公告)日:2021-08-06

    申请号:CN202110117634.5

    申请日:2021-01-28

    Abstract: 通信装置包括主机接口,该主机接口连接到外围组件总线,以便与主机计算机的CPU和存储器通信。网络接口连接到网络。分组处理电路被配置为从第一接口接收数据分组,该数据分组包括一个或多个报头的集合,该报头包括具有各自值的报头字段,响应于报头字段中的至少一个来识别报头修改表中指定报头修改操作的对应条目,根据报头修改操作修改报头集合,检查条目是否指定了附加报头修改操作,如果条目未指定附加报头修改操作,则输出修改的报头集合,并且如果该条目指定了附加报头修改操作,则反馈修改的报头集合。

    多主机网络适配器中的拥塞控制度量

    公开(公告)号:CN113612696B

    公开(公告)日:2024-08-13

    申请号:CN202110443664.5

    申请日:2021-04-23

    Abstract: 网络适配器包括主机接口、网络接口、存储器和分组处理电路。存储器包含共享缓冲器和分配给多个主机处理器的多个队列。分组处理电路被配置为从网络接口接收目的地为主机处理器的数据分组,以将至少一些数据分组的净荷存储在共享缓冲器中,以通过在队列之中应用调度将至少一些数据分组的报头分配给队列以来将分组提供给主机处理器,以检测在主机处理器中目的地为给定主机处理器的数据分组中的拥塞,并响应于所检测到的拥塞,以减轻目的地为给定主机处理器的数据分组中的拥塞,同时保持目的地为其他主机处理器的数据分组的不间断处理。

    网络设备中的灵活解析器

    公开(公告)号:CN112953829B

    公开(公告)日:2022-09-13

    申请号:CN202011409501.7

    申请日:2020-12-04

    Abstract: 一个实施方式包括网络设备,该网络设备包括:硬件解析器,用于接收分组的报头部分的数据,该报头部分包括各个报头;解析器配置寄存器,用于存储默认解析配置数据集,其中,至少一个硬件解析器被配置为响应于默认解析配置数据集解析至少一个报头,产生第一解析数据;分组处理引擎,用于响应于第一解析数据从解析配置数据集的选择中选择所选择的解析配置数据集,将所选择的解析配置数据集加载到解析器配置寄存器中,并且其中硬件解析器中的一些被配置为响应于所选择的解析配置数据集来解析报头中的各个报头,产生第二解析数据,并响应于第二解析数据处理分组。

    网络适配器中的带宽控制策略器

    公开(公告)号:CN114827051A

    公开(公告)日:2022-07-29

    申请号:CN202210050471.8

    申请日:2022-01-17

    Abstract: 一种网络适配器包含网络接口、主机接口和处理电路。所述网络接口被配置为连接到通信网络。所述主机接口被配置为与运行多个应用程序的主机处理器通信。所述处理电路包含一个或多个带宽控制策略器,并且被配置为从所述通信网络接收去往在所述主机处理器上运行的所述应用程序中的给定应用程序的分组而将从所述带宽控制策略器中选定的带宽控制策略器与所述分组相关联,并且将所述选定的带宽控制策略器应用于所述分组以产生策略器结果。

    网络设备中的灵活解析器
    10.
    发明公开

    公开(公告)号:CN112953829A

    公开(公告)日:2021-06-11

    申请号:CN202011409501.7

    申请日:2020-12-04

    Abstract: 一个实施方式包括网络设备,该网络设备包括:硬件解析器,用于接收分组的报头部分的数据,该报头部分包括各个报头;解析器配置寄存器,用于存储默认解析配置数据集,其中,至少一个硬件解析器被配置为响应于默认解析配置数据集解析至少一个报头,产生第一解析数据;分组处理引擎,用于响应于第一解析数据从解析配置数据集的选择中选择所选择的解析配置数据集,将所选择的解析配置数据集加载到解析器配置寄存器中,并且其中硬件解析器中的一些被配置为响应于所选择的解析配置数据集来解析报头中的各个报头,产生第二解析数据,并响应于第二解析数据处理分组。

Patent Agency Ranking